Regime-Aware Portfolio Robustness Across Emerging and Developed Equity Markets

Abstract

The research investigates how portfolio optimization techniques maintain their effectiveness during different market conditions which affect both emerging and developed equity markets by studying In¬dia and Singapore as case studies. The analysis compares mean–variance, minimum variance, equally weighted, and Conditional Value-at-Risk (CVaR) portfolios under both stable and stress market condi¬tions. The research identifies market regimes through a drawdown-based framework which uses an XGBoost classifier that processes macro-financial data including equity index returns and exchange rate movements and implied volatility indicators. The findings show that diversification strategies achieve better results in emerging markets which experience constant market changes while CVaR-based op-timization delivers better protection against losses and enhanced results in developed markets with extended stressful periods. The results demonstrate that portfolio strength and optimization success depend on the specific market conditions which affect different regimes.
